Mast cell inhibition refers to the process of suppressing or modulating the activation and function of mast cells, which are immune cells involved in allergic reactions, inflammation, and host defense. Mast cell inhibition can be achieved by targeting specific receptors or signaling pathways that regulate mast cell degranulation and mediator release.
Suppression or modulation of mast cell activation and function by targeting receptors (FcεRI, KIT, Siglecs, CD200R, MRGPRX2) or signaling pathways (MAPK, Ca²⁺ influx, NF-κB) that regulate mast cell degranulation and mediator release.
